<br />22 CITY OF LAKE ELMO, MN <br /> <br /> <br />Figure 13: Street Miles / Streets FTE <br /> <br />This trend is seen again when considering the miles of water pipe maintained per Water FTE, shown in Figure 14. <br />Lake Elmo maintains 37.3 miles of water pipe per Water FTE, while Oakdale, the second-leanest city, maintains <br />fewer than 30 miles per Water FTE.
